Transaction 3fc5c8143019db7dda7badf2f8837561c3cada6816f620dc7093def9a9f5826a
1 Input
1 Output
-
3fc5c8143019db7dda7badf2f8837561c3cada6816f620dc7093def9a9f5826a:0
- value
- 2499990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d10fdf179c847209af64c48b7f943b0257a5f4b2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L4RErun7thrNRz4qKHXq3ar61az83Q9tF